Transaction 71ac732992f02c0fc315f15dee36afb7b3f95a2556406bbbf2b09924e80c33e6

1 Input
2 Outputs
  • 71ac732992f02c0fc315f15dee36afb7b3f95a2556406bbbf2b09924e80c33e6:0
  • value  648946
    address  3N3H6EfSbsnMixsEwFjEg7tsHzBsiADbwZ
  • 71ac732992f02c0fc315f15dee36afb7b3f95a2556406bbbf2b09924e80c33e6:1
  • value  42188901
    address  bc1q4ma0nvausznnwm76df6ltczcdklcwtcu9zg7em